#46f620 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#46f620 is composed of 27.5% red, 96.5%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 87%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 109.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 54.5%. #46f620 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cff40 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#46f620
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f2feef is the lightest one.

Tones of #46f620
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#859482 is the less saturated color, while #40ff17 is the most saturated one.
